Based on the summary of the investigations on the leaching process of indium,zinc oxidation slag dust as well as the application of mechanical activation and pressure oxidation in non-ferrous metallurgy,the effects of different technologcial conditions and leaching process on leaching efficiency of indium in the reaction of zinc oxidation slag dust with sulfuric acid by mechanical activation or pressure oxidation was studied,we can get the optimum conditions of leaching indium.From the experiments,conclusions can be drawn as follow:(1)The technology of leaching indium in the reaction of zinc oxidation slag dust with sulfuric acid by mechanical activation or pressure oxidation with oxidant can improve the leaching efficiency of indium and decrease the leaching time.So two new path for enhancing leaching indium from zinc oxidation slag dust can be provided.In the orthorhombic experiment of mechanical activation in a stirring mill,the effect of each factor on leaching efficiency of indium is:the initial concentration of acid>stirring speed>reaction time>ratio of liquid-solid.(2)Associating with the equipment and the cost of energy,the optimum conditions of leaching indium by the mechanical activation in a stirring mill are:the reaction time is 150 min,the ratio of liquid-solid is 8,the initial concentration of sulfuric acid is 5 mol/L,the stirring speed is 575 r/min.In the optimum conditions the leaching efficiency of indium which was 68.0%in conventional leaching process was improved to 91.2%.(3)Associating with the equipment and the cost of energy,the optimum conditions of leaching indium by pressure oxidation with hydrogen peroxide in a high pressure reaction kettle are:the reaction time is 150 min,the ratio of liquid-solid is 8,the initial concentration of sulfuric acid is 5 mol/L,the stirring speed is 575 r/min,reacting temperature is 90℃,air pressure is 0.5 MPa,the dosage of 30%hydrogen peroxide is 0.5 mL/g.In the optimum conditions the leaching efficiency of indium which was 77.6%in conventional leaching process(90℃)without oxidant was improved to 90.2%.The optimum conditions of leaching indium by pressure oxidation with potassium permanganate in a high pressure reaction kettle are:the reaction time is 150 min,the ratio of liquid-solid is 8,the initial concentration of sulfuric acid is 3 mol/L,the stirring speed is 575 r/min,reacting temperature is 90℃,air pressure is 0.5 MPa,the dosage of potassium permanganate is 25 g/kg.In the conditions the leaching efficiency of indium which was 77.6%in conventional leaching process(90℃,the initial concentration of sulfuric acid is 5 mol/L)without oxidant was improved to 89.5%.(4)In the condition of dilute initial concentration of acid,the leaching efficiency of indium is better in pressure oxidation process than mechanical activation process because of the application of hydrogen peroxide in the leaching process.In the condition of dilute initial concentration of acid,we can get the best leaching efficiency of indium by pressure oxidation with potassium permanganate.And when the initial concentration of acid is dense,the leaching efficiency of indium by pressure oxidation with potassium permanganate is the best in all of the processes.
